With principal photography underway on ‘The End We Start from’, starring BAFTA and Emmy award-winning actor Jodie Comer and directed by BAFTA award-winning director Mahalia Belo (EllenRequiemThe Long Song) a first look image has been released.

Based on the heart-wrenching novel by Megan Hunter and adapted for the screen by BAFTA nominated Alice Birch (Normal People, Succession, The Wonder), the film is a powerful hopeful story about the trials and joys of new motherhood in the midst of devastating floods that swallow up the city of London.

When an environmental crisis sees London submerged by flood waters, a young family is torn apart in the chaos. As a woman and her newborn try to find their way home, the profound novelty of motherhood is brought into sharp focus in this dystopian portrayal of family survival and hope.

‘My character is ordinary and extraordinary, both her very personal life and the world around her have been turned upside down and she is dealing with the unknown at every turn. Her story is about the quiet heroics of determination, devotion, bravery and love’ said Comer.

Cast members joining Comer include Joel Fry (Cruella, Yesterday), BAFTA nominee Mark Strong (1917, Kingsman), BAFTA award-winning Gina McKee (My Policeman, Line Of Duty), Katherine Waterston (Fantastic Beasts, The World To Come), Nina Sosanya (Screw, His Dark Materials) and two-time Academy Award nominee and BAFTA award-winning Benedict Cumberbatch.
